Watch a technical presentation from Dr Franck Cassez exploring research findings on implementing Verifiable Random Functions (VRFs) for achieving fair transaction sequencing in rollups. Delve into the mathematical and cryptographic principles behind VRFs and understand how they can be leveraged to create more equitable transaction ordering systems within blockchain rollup solutions. Learn about the practical implications and potential benefits of implementing VRF-based sequencing mechanisms for improving fairness and reducing manipulation in rollup transaction processing.
